Based on a popular series of video games, DOA: DEAD OR ALIVE is set on an exotic island where a group of extraordinary men and women face off against each other in a single-elimination fighting competition for a $10 million winner-take-all prize. The film focuses on three main competitors: Tina Armstrong (Jaime Pressly), a professional wrestler who wants to prove to herself, and the world, that she's not a fake; Princess Kasumi (Devon Aoki), who has gone against the laws of her kingdom by escaping on her own in order to search for her missing brother (Collin Chou), a former DOA participant; and Christie (Holly Valance), who, along with the mysterious Max (Matthew Marsden), is more interested in the $100 million locked away in a hidden vault than in the fighting prize. But the winner is going to have to get past some of the toughest men in the world, including Tina's father (real-life professional wrestler Kevin Nash) and island favorite Bayman (real-life six-time World's Strongest Man champion Derek Boyer). Meanwhile, behind the scenes, geeky nerd Weatherby (Steve Howey) is rooting for Helena (Sarah Carter), whose late father started the event, which is now in the hands of the questionably motivated Donovan (Eric Roberts). DOA: DEAD OR ALIVE was helmed by longtime Hong Kong actor, director, writer, and action director Corey Yuen (THE TRANSPORTER, KISS OF THE DRAGON) and features music by Junkie XL. [More]
